What Are the Common Causes of CPU Performance Issues in Windows?

– Background processes consuming excessive CPU resources
– Poor power plan configuration
– Outdated drivers and firmware
– Malware or unnecessary startup programs
– Thermal throttling due to overheating
– System clutter and registry errors

How Can You Identify CPU Bottlenecks?

Start by examining your system’s resource usage:

1. Open Task Manager (Ctrl + Shift + Esc).
2. Click on the Performance tab and select CPU. Monitor the percentage usage and identify any spikes or sustained high usage.
3. Go to the Processes tab to see which applications and background processes are consuming the most CPU.

What Built-in Windows Settings Can Be Tweaked for CPU Performance?

Adjust Power Plan Settings

1. Open Control Panel, go to Hardware and Sound > Power Options.
2. Select High Performance or create a custom plan tailored to your needs.
3. Click Change plan settings > Change advanced power settings.
4. Expand Processor power management and set both Minimum and Maximum processor state to 100% for intensive workloads (note: this may increase power consumption and heat).

Disable Unnecessary Startup Programs

1. In Task Manager, go to the Startup tab.
2. Disable any programs you don’t need to launch at startup. This frees up CPU cycles and memory.

Update Device Drivers

1. Right-click the Start button and select Device Manager.
2. Expand the Processors section and right-click your CPU, then click Update driver.
3. Repeat for other key components like chipset and storage controllers.

What Advanced Steps Can Be Taken for Further CPU Tuning?

Adjust Visual Effects

1. Press Windows + R, type sysdm.cpl, and press Enter.
2. Go to the Advanced tab > Performance > Settings.
3. Select Adjust for best performance, or manually choose which effects to disable.

Check for Thermal Throttling

Use a utility like HWMonitor or Core Temp to track CPU temperatures. If temperatures are consistently high, clean dust from your cooling system or consider reapplying thermal paste.

Scan for Malware

Malware can cause unexplained CPU spikes. Run a full antivirus scan with Windows Security or your preferred security suite.

Consider BIOS/UEFI Updates

Manufacturers sometimes release firmware updates that improve CPU performance and compatibility. Visit your motherboard or laptop vendor’s website for the latest BIOS/UEFI updates.
